Mariam F Haji-Hersi's research focuses on factors influencing medication adherence in breast cancer patients, particularly endocrine therapy. Her work investigates drug- and patient-related predictors that are identified as the strongest influences on adherence.
Haji-Hersi has one publication to her name, "Drug- and patient-related factors are the strongest predictors of endocrine therapy adherence in breast cancer patients," published in 2021. Her scholarship metrics include an h-index of 1 and a total of 9 citations across her publications. She has collaborated with Sophia Tilley, Caleb A Shelton, and Landry K. Kamdem, all from Harding University Main Campus, on shared publications.
